The IEEE Lafayette Section is hosting a Professional Development Talk aimed at empowering members and young professionals with insights to enhance their careers and leadership skills. This session will feature experienced industry and academic speakers who will share their perspectives on career growth, technical innovation, and professional success in the evolving engineering landscape.

Participants will gain valuable guidance on topics such as effective networking, leveraging IEEE opportunities, skill development, and adapting to emerging technologies. The event will also provide a great opportunity to connect with peers, mentors, and leaders within the IEEE community.

  Speakers

Samantha Fowler

Topic:

Career Acceleration with AI: Smarter Job Search and Applications

Biography:

Sam Fowler is currently studying computer engineering at the University of Louisiana at Lafayette, pursuing a Ph.D. Sam is employed at Argonne National Laboratory as a research aide within the Mathematics and Computer Science (MCS) department in conjunction with the Advanced Photon Source (APS). Her research focuses on Deep Neural Networks and converting them to on-chip systems to run near detector for real time results.
